Trip Preparation Transportation Getting around the city: Primarily by walking, with trams or ferries used for some attractions. Suomenlinna Transport: Take the Suomenlinna Ferry, €3.1 one way, with a journey time of about 15 minutes. (We recommend downloading the HSL App for easy ticket purchasing.) To Rovaniemi: Take the VR Santa Claus Express; the sleeper train journey takes about 12 hours, departing from Helsinki and arriving in Rovaniemi early the next morning. Booking website: VR official website Accommodation Tonight's accommodation is in the VR Santa Claus Express sleeper carriage, and we are divided into: For men, the lower-floor private booths do not have a toilet (1750 TWD per person).

Old Market Hall: Salmon Soup & Local Food Experience After finishing the Suomenlinna tour, we returned to the pier and headed to the famous Old Market Hall (Vanha Kauppahalli). There are many local specialties here, with the salmon soup being the most famous. It is rich and creamy, with large, tender pieces of salmon, making it an absolute must-eat delicacy in Helsinki!

Silent Chapel: Minimalist design, a place to calm the soul. The last chapel to visit is the Kampin kappeli. This chapel features a simple oval wooden structure with minimal interior decoration, primarily offering people a peaceful space suitable for quiet reflection and prayer.

Finnish Sauna Experience: A Traditional Sauna Ritual of Extreme Temperature Differences When visiting Finland, how can you not experience an authentic Finnish sauna? We visited a public sauna to experience the ritual of "high-temperature sauna followed by low-temperature cooling." The traditional way is to jump directly from the sauna into a zero-degree seawater pool, then return to the sauna to sweat. I plucked up my courage to try it once, and as a result, my whole body felt a stinging sensation when I got up!
